The sample is a PDF file identified as malicious by multiple heuristics, including a critical detection for CVE-2010-0188, an Adobe Reader LibTIFF XFA image exploit. This indicates the file is designed to exploit this vulnerability to achieve code execution on the victim's machine. The presence of XFA form elements further supports the exploit vector.

  • Adobe Reader LibTIFF XFA image exploit — CVE-2010-0188 critical CVE likely CVE_2010_0188
    PDF contains the CVE-2010-0188 exploit template: XFA JavaScript heap-spray setup, a generated TIFF image payload, and assignment of that TIFF data to an XFA image field rawValue to trigger Adobe Reader's LibTIFF parser.
